Job Summary
The Receptionist & Sales Coordinator is responsible for providing exceptional
customer service to all clients and visitors while supporting sales activities
related to memberships and renewals. This role ensures a professional,
welcoming front desk experience and contributes to achieving the center’s
enrollment and retention goals.
